#e9fe48 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e9fe48 is composed of 91.4% red, 99.6%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 8.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 71.7% yellow and 0.4% black. It has a hue angle of 66.9 degrees, a saturation of 98.9% and a lightness of 63.9%. #e9fe48 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ff90 with #d3fd00. Closest websafe color is: #ffff33.

Shades and Tints of #e9fe48

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0c00 is the darkest color, while #fefff8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e9fe48

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a8a99d is the less saturated color, while #e9fe48 is the most saturated one.
